Перейти к основному содержимому

Сетевые диски облачного сервера

Последнее изменение:

Сетевые диски — это масштабируемые блочные устройства, которые можно легко переносить между облачными серверами. Подходят для масштабирования дискового пространства сервера без изменения загрузочного диска. Трехкратная репликация томов диска обеспечивает высокую сохранность данных.

Сетевой диск можно создать вместе с облачным сервером или создать отдельно, а затем создать из него сервер или подключить к серверу как дополнительный диск.

С сетевыми дисками можно работать в панели управления, с помощью OpenStack CLI или Terraform.

Вы можете отслеживать метрики по сетевым дискам облачных серверов с помощью сервиса Метрики.

Записи об операциях с сетевыми дисками сохраняются в аудит-логах.

Особенности сетевых дисков

Типы сетевых дисков

  • HDD Базовый — HDD-диск на базе SATA-дисков enterprise-класса. Подходит для хранения больших объемов данных, которые не нужно часто читать или перезаписывать;
  • SSD Базовый — SSD-диск для задач, в которых не требуется высокая скорость чтения и записи. Пропускная способность и IOPS выше, чем у базового HDD;
  • SSD Универсальный — SSD-диск, подходит для использования в качестве загрузочного диска облачного сервера;
  • SSD Универсальный v2 — SSD-диск с возможностью изменения лимита IOPS и без фиксированного разделения количества операций на чтение и запись. Подходит для задач с неравномерной нагрузкой. При выборе максимального количества IOPS подходит для CRM-систем, систем мониторинга и для работы с большими данными;
  • SSD Быстрый — SSD NVMe-диск с меньшим временем отклика и большей скоростью работы по сравнению с другими типами. Подходит для нагрузок, которые требуют высокой скорости чтения и записи.
  • SSD Быстрый v2 — SSD NVMe-диск с возможностью изменения лимита IOPS и без фиксированного разделения количества операций на чтение и запись. Подходит для задач, которые требуют высокие скорости ввода-вывода и уровень отказоустойчивости.

Типы дисков отличаются рекомендуемыми ограничениями на размер, значениями пропускной способности и количеством операций на чтение и запись. Подробнее в таблице Лимиты сетевых дисков.

В разных сегментах пула доступны разные типы дисков. Посмотреть доступность типов можно в матрице доступности Сетевые диски облачной платформы.

Посмотреть список ID и имен типов можно в подразделе Список типов сетевого диска.

Лимиты сетевых дисков

Максимальный размер загрузочных и дополнительных сетевых дисков, значения пропускной способности и количество IOPS зависят от типа диска.

Диски одного типа в разных сегментах пула могут иметь разные лимиты. Например, если два сетевых диска с типом SSD Универсальный находятся в разных сегментах (первый диск в ru-1c, второй — в ru-8a), их лимиты будут различаться.

Максимальный размер для загрузочного дискаМаксимальный размер для дополнительного дискаПропускная способность
(блоки 4 МБ)
Количество операций
(чтение, блоки 4 КБ)
Количество операций
(запись, блоки 4 КБ)
HDD Базовый
(все доступные сегменты пула)
500 ГБ10 ТБ100 МБ/с320 IOPS120 IOPS
SSD Базовый
(ru-2b, ru-2c, ru-3b, ru-7a, ru-7b, ru-8a, ru-9a)
500 ГБ10 ТБ150 МБ/с640 IOPS320 IOPS
SSD Универсальный
(ru-1a, ru-1b, ru-1c, ru-2a, ru-3a)
2 ТБ10 ТБ150 МБ/с640 IOPS320 IOPS
SSD Универсальный
(ru-2b, ru-2c, ru-3b, ru-7a, ru-7b, ru-8a, ru-9a, gis-1a, gis-2a, uz-1a, uz-2a, kz-1a, ke-1a)
5 ТБ10 ТБ200 МБ/с7 000 IOPS4 000 IOPS
SSD
Универсальный v2
(ru-2c, ru-3b, ru-6a, ru-6b, ru-6c, ru-7a, ru-7b, ru-8a, ru-9a, gis-1a, gis-2a, uz-1a, uz-2a, kz-1a, ke-1a)
10 ТБ10 ТБ200 МБ/с2 000 — 16 000 IOPS
(без разделения
на чтение и запись)
SSD Быстрый
(ru-1a, ru-1b, ru-1c, ru-2a, ru-2b, ru-3a)
2 ТБ10 ТБ500 МБ/с12 800 IOPS6 400 IOPS
SSD Быстрый
(ru-2c, ru-3b, ru-7a, ru-7b, ru-8a, ru-9a, gis-1a, gis-2a, uz-1a, uz-2a, kz-1a, ke-1a)
10 ТБ10 ТБ500 МБ/с25 000 IOPS15 000 IOPS
SSD Быстрый v2
(ru-6a, ru-6b, ru-6c)
10 ТБ10 ТБ1 000 МБ/с25 000 — 75 000 IOPS
(без разделения
на чтение и запись)

Вы можете протестировать производительность дисков.

Что влияет на производительность

Разные типы дисков имеют разные значения IOPS — число операций чтения и записи в секунду. Создание и проверка файловой системы — это процедуры, которые требуют выполнения определенного количества операций чтения и записи на диск. Чем производительнее диск, тем быстрее завершаются данные операции.

При первом запуске облачного сервера файловая система на системном диске «растягивается» по размеру диска. Чем больше размер диска и чем ниже у него лимиты на IOPS, тем дольше будет длиться этот процесс — следовательно, дольше будет запускаться облачный сервер.

Размер файловой системы влияет на время проверки ее состояния в случае аварийного завершения работы сервера. Проверка включена по умолчанию для загрузочных (системных) дисков всех серверов, которые создаются из готовых образов.

Список типов сетевого диска

Для создания сетевых дисков через OpenStack CLI и Terraform используются ID или имена типов сетевого диска. ID и имена различаются в сегментах пула.

примечание

Например, 94350392-3e5c-4b5a-8a51-873f02af833b — ID, а basicssd.ru-9a — имя для создания сетевого диска с типом SSD Базовый в сегменте пула ru-9a.

Можно посмотреть список типов сетевого диска во всех сегментах пула в таблице или посмотреть список типов сетевого диска в определенном пуле через OpenStack CLI.

Список типов сетевого диска во всех сегментах пула

IDИмя
f42f37b2-062f-4ce2-a6b3-28ca5e619030basic.ru-3a
de922498-6af2-4972-840d-36c5e6790b87basicssd.ru-3b
fca113dd-a80f-4996-be54-cf2515d4ddeeuniversal.ru-3a
9c16598e-342b-4ff2-b948-8c05cf8f1490fast.ru-3a
52cb3250-dbea-4ba6-bbde-b5607f1ca545basic.ru-3b
669c3c07-83e3-4e44-8499-d13d379e79eeuniversal.ru-3b
bbc41cd5-d112-4e19-a781-baf44fb690d3fast.ru-3b
0959f227-26c1-46e6-afed-09e040a80af1universal2.ru-3b

Здесь:

  • ID — ID типа сетевого диска;
  • Имя — имя типа сетевого диска и сегмент пула в формате тип.сегмент_пула, например basic.ru-9a. Доступные типы:
    • basic — тип HDD Базовый;
    • basicssd — тип SSD Базовый;
    • universal — тип SSD Универсальный;
    • universal2 — тип SSD Универсальный v2;
    • fast — тип SSD Быстрый;
    • fast2 — тип SSD Быстрый v2.

Посмотреть список типов сетевого диска в определенном пуле

  1. Откройте OpenStack CLI.

  2. Посмотрите список типов:

    openstack volume type list

    Пример ответа для пула ru-9:

    +--------------------------------------+-----------------+
    | ID | Name |
    +--------------------------------------+-----------------+
    | 8ab097f3-3ffc-4fc4-9771-01fd512936eb | basic.ru-9a |
    | 94350392-3e5c-4b5a-8a51-873f02af833b | basicssd.ru-9a |
    | 52666f65-ec91-4c09-ad7e-207d10553e4a | universal.ru-9a |
    | 2eab725b-4797-4c34-9e1b-4ad083629608 | universal2.ru-9a|
    | a67bd670-633b-4c82-bb91-84058140aa05 | fast.ru-9a |
    +--------------------------------------+-----------------+

    Здесь:

    • ID — ID типа сетевого диска;
    • Name — имя типа сетевого диска и сегмент пула в формате тип.сегмент_пула, например basic.ru-9a. Доступные типы:
      • basic — тип HDD Базовый;
      • basicssd — тип SSD Базовый;
      • universal — тип SSD Универсальный;
      • universal2 — тип SSD Универсальный v2;
      • fast — тип SSD Быстрый.

Стоимость

Сетевые диски оплачиваются по модели оплаты облачной платформы.

Оплачивается каждый ГБ сетевых дисков. Стоимость зависит от типа сетевого диска, размера и сегмента пула, в котором он расположен.

Размер сетевого диска можно посмотреть в панели управления: в верхнем меню нажмите ПродуктыОблачные серверы → раздел Диски → строка диска → столбец Размер.

Для сетевых дисков типа SSD Универсальный v2 и SSD Быстрый v2 также оплачивается количество используемых IOPS. Учитывается максимальное количество IOPS в час. Для SSD Универсальный v2 первые 2 000 IOPS предоставляются бесплатно, для SSD Быстрый v2 — первые 25 000 IOPS. Количество IOPS можно посмотреть в панели управления: в верхнем меню нажмите ПродуктыОблачные серверы → раздел Диски → страница диска → вкладка Настройки.

Стоимость одного ГБ (для всех типов сетевого диска) и одного IOPS (для дисков типа SSD Универсальный v2 и SSD Быстрый v2) можно посмотреть на selectel.ru.